FILE - In this Nov. 2014, file photo provided by Fermilab, Physics Nobel Prize winner Dr. Leon M. Lederman poses for a photo in Batavia, Ill. Lederman, an experimental physicist who won a Nobel Prize in physics for his work on subatomic particles and coined the phrase "God particle," has died. Ellen Carr Lederman, his wife of 37 years, said her husband died Wednesday, Oct. 3, 2018, at a nursing home in the Idaho town of Rexburg. He was 96. (Reidar Hahn, Fermilab via AP, file)
